背景介绍
在当今数字化时代,网站的加载速度和性能已经成为用户体验的关键因素之一,随着前端技术的不断发展,开发者们越来越关注如何提升网页的响应速度和渲染效率,CDN(内容分发网络)作为一种高效的资源传输方式,逐渐成为前端开发的标配工具,本文将深入探讨如何在项目中引入CDN文件,以优化Web性能。
CDN的基本概念
CDN是内容分发网络的简称,它是通过在全球各地部署服务器节点,将网站的内容缓存到离用户最近的节点上,从而加速内容的传输和访问速度,当用户请求网站资源时,CDN会根据用户的地理位置、网络条件等因素,动态调度最优的节点来响应请求,从而提高资源的加载速度和可用性。
引入CDN文件的优势
1、加速资源加载:CDN可以将静态资源缓存到全球各地的节点上,用户可以从最近的节点获取资源,减少了传输延迟和时间。
2、减轻源站压力:通过CDN分发资源,可以有效减少源服务器的压力,提高其稳定性和可靠性。
3、提高网站可用性:即使源站出现故障或宕机,CDN仍然可以通过其他节点提供资源,保证网站的正常访问。
4、优化用户体验:快速的资源加载速度可以显著提升用户体验,降低跳出率,增加用户留存。
如何在项目中引入CDN文件
需要选择一个合适的CDN服务提供商,常见的CDN服务提供商有阿里云CDN、腾讯云CDN、七牛云CDN等,这些提供商都提供了丰富的CDN服务和功能,可以根据项目需求选择合适的方案。
在选择好CDN服务提供商后,需要在控制台中配置CDN加速域名,具体步骤一般包括:添加加速域名、配置CNAME记录、设置HTTPS证书等,配置完成后,CDN服务提供商会为该域名分配相应的节点和缓存策略。
在项目的代码中引入CDN资源,这通常涉及到修改HTML文件中的<link>
标签或<script>
标签,将资源的URL替换为CDN加速后的URL。
<!-- 原始资源引用 --> <link rel="stylesheet" href="https://example.com/styles.css"> <script src="https://example.com/scripts.js"></script> <!-- 引入CDN资源后 --> <link rel="stylesheet" href="https://cdn.example.com/styles.css"> <script src="https://cdn.example.com/scripts.js"></script>
通过以上步骤,就可以实现项目中CDN资源的引入和加速。
注意事项
1、缓存策略设置:在使用CDN时,需要注意缓存策略的设置,合理的缓存策略可以提高资源的加载速度,但同时也要注意避免缓存过期导致的内容更新问题。
2、HTTPS支持:为了保障资源的安全性,建议使用支持HTTPS的CDN服务,并确保所有资源都通过HTTPS协议进行传输。
3、监控与日志分析:定期监控CDN服务的性能指标和日志信息,及时发现和解决问题,确保CDN服务的稳定运行。
引入CDN文件是优化Web性能的重要手段之一,通过合理配置和使用CDN服务,可以显著加速资源的加载速度,提升用户体验和网站的可用性,也需要注意缓存策略、HTTPS支持以及监控与日志分析等方面的问题,以确保CDN服务的稳定和高效运行,希望本文能够帮助大家更好地理解和应用CDN技术,为前端开发带来更多的可能性和机遇。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态